Russian Qt Forum
Ноябрь 25, 2024, 06:14 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

Войти
 
  Начало   Форум  WIKI (Вики)FAQ Помощь Поиск Войти Регистрация  

Страниц: [1]   Вниз
  Печать  
Автор Тема: LimeReport - Open-source Qt генератор отчетов, релиз новой версии 1.5  (Прочитано 29423 раз)
TEHb
Новичок

Offline Offline

Сообщений: 23


Просмотр профиля
« : Июль 19, 2019, 10:17 »

1. Многостраничность
2. Диалоги
3. Добавлены светлая и темная тема в дизайнере отчетов.
4. Инициализационный скрипт
5. Уменьшено потребление памяти
6. Переработан объект управления источниками данных
7. Добавлено контекстное меню у элементов отчета
8. Добавлена возможность использовать QJSEngine вместо устаревшего QtScript.
9. Улучшен визуальный дизайнер отчетов.
10. Добавлена поддержка дюймов.
11. Добавлен встроенный редактор диалогов.
12. Улучшен редактор скриптов.
13. Добавлена возможность сборки библиотеки без встроенного визуального редактора отчетов.
14. Добавлена возможность создавать многоязычные отчеты.
15. Добавлена возможность обработки событий времени генерации отчета посредством скриптов.
16. Добавлена возможность создания оглавления отчета.
17. Добавлена вертикальная группировка.
18. Добавлена возможность передавать изображение в отчет через переменную отчета.
19. Добавлена возможность печати на рулоне.
20. Добавлена печать одной страницы отчета на нескольких листах бумаги.
21. Добавлена возможность печати на нескольких принтерах.
22. Добавлен компонент для отображения графиков.
23. Добавлена возможность использовать групповые функции в заголовках.
24. Добавлена возможность создавать промежуточные итоги в нижнем колонтитуле страницы.
25. Улучшен режим редактирования результатов генерации отчетов.
26. ... много других небольших улучшений и исправлений ошибок.

Официальный сайт: http://www.limereport.ru Ссылка для скачивания: https://github.com/fralx/LimeReport либо https://sourceforge.net/projects/limereport/

Приветствуются мнения пользователей, обсуждение необходимых фич, багов. Прямое общение с разработчиком на форуме официального сайта.
Записан
m_ax
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 2095



Просмотр профиля
« Ответ #1 : Июль 20, 2019, 15:21 »

Молодцы!
Записан

Над водой луна двурога. Сяду выпью за Ван Гога. Хорошо, что кот не пьет, Он и так меня поймет..

Arch Linux Plasma 5
nsa.qt
Новичок

Offline Offline

Сообщений: 6


Просмотр профиля
« Ответ #2 : Апрель 29, 2020, 17:36 »

Добрый день.
Существует ли документация для разработчика.
Имеющаяся документация в очень урезанном виде.
Записан
ViTech
Гипер активный житель
*****
Offline Offline

Сообщений: 858



Просмотр профиля
« Ответ #3 : Апрель 29, 2020, 19:04 »

Добрый день.
Существует ли документация для разработчика.
Имеющаяся документация в очень урезанном виде.

Прямое общение с разработчиком на форуме официального сайта.

Думается мне, здесь быстрее ответят Улыбающийся.
Записан

Пока сам не сделаешь...
Racheengel
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 2679


Я работал с дискетам 5.25 :(


Просмотр профиля
« Ответ #4 : Октябрь 23, 2020, 10:36 »

1.5.35, 1.5.72 - не работает под 10-й виндой.
Отчёты видны в дизайнере, но когда загружаешь их через код, не работает ни превью, ни печать.
На "официальном форуме" сломана регистрация, а без неё нельзя оставить пост :/
Записан

What is the 11 in the C++11? It’s the number of feet they glued to C++ trying to obtain a better octopus.

COVID не волк, в лес не уйдёт
Hellraiser
Бывалый
*****
Offline Offline

Сообщений: 451


Просмотр профиля
« Ответ #5 : Октябрь 23, 2020, 10:52 »

Может чего-то не хватает? Я делал отчет в 1.5.35, потом заменил библиотеку на 1.5.72 - все работает и под 7-ой и под 10-ой Виндой. Но датасурсы для отчета я задаю в своем коде, в шаблоне отчета их не храню. MSVS 2017, Qt 5.12.9 x86.
« Последнее редактирование: Октябрь 23, 2020, 10:54 от Hellraiser » Записан
Racheengel
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 2679


Я работал с дискетам 5.25 :(


Просмотр профиля
« Ответ #6 : Октябрь 23, 2020, 15:56 »

я сделал в дизайнере тестовый шаблон со статическим текстом в хедере, вообще без данных.
когда в коде его гружу и пытаюсь выдать на печать (что может быть проще?), он вроде грузится без ошибок, но не генерирует ни одной страницы.

Windows 10, Qt 5.13.2, VS 2017, x64.
Записан

What is the 11 in the C++11? It’s the number of feet they glued to C++ trying to obtain a better octopus.

COVID не волк, в лес не уйдёт
Hellraiser
Бывалый
*****
Offline Offline

Сообщений: 451


Просмотр профиля
« Ответ #7 : Октябрь 23, 2020, 16:28 »

Возможно нужен датабэнд, пусть даже пустой. У меня отчет для печати этикеток - 48 штук на листе. В отчете есть скрипты, а данные берутся из QSqlQuery, которая в коде передается как модель данных для отчета. Все работает, хотя и не без косяков. Например, границы печати - задаются дробной величиной, а потом округляются до целого, причем такое поведение только для страницы отчета. Для меня это было критично, т.к. надо было точно попасть в этикетку. Выкрутился - верх/низ страницы задал как целое, а потом добавил пустые хидер и футер с дробным размером. Вообще, хочу сказать, что среди бесплатных генераторов отчетов такого функционала вообще ни у кого нет. Есть косяки с переводом, но это OpenSource, никто не мешает добавить свое или исправить.
Записан
__Heaven__
Джедай : наставник для всех
*******
Offline Offline

Сообщений: 2130



Просмотр профиля
« Ответ #8 : Октябрь 23, 2020, 20:07 »

Молодцы, спасибо!

Документацию нашёл в папке docs https://github.com/fralx/LimeReport/blob/master/docs/UserManualRu.pdf
Записан
Страниц: [1]   Вверх
  Печать  
 
Перейти в:  


Страница сгенерирована за 0.055 секунд. Запросов: 23.